On 8/25/2013 3:44 PM, Howard Lester wrote:
> I recall it was the Skylark line of Lutron dimmers I installed in my
> [former] house over 10 years ago. I found them also to be quite quiet.

OK, we seem to have that dragon slain -- the unanimous response is
Lutron. From studying data sheets, I see that the Maestro line data
sheet lists them as compliant with Class B Part 15.

Now the next dragon -- a clean switching power supply for low voltage
lighting that fits in backboxes for lighting fixtures. Transformers with
sufficient power ratings are much too large.
